@kidswong999 删除mag这段也没用。
单独的get_regression程序就可以运行
1
13413694082
@13413694082
0
声望
20
楼层
671
资料浏览
0
粉丝
0
关注
13413694082 发布的帖子
-
RE: 巡线小车运行程序,一直出现IDE interrupt,无法运行得到所巡的线!
-
RE: 巡线小车运行程序,一直出现IDE interrupt,无法运行得到所巡的线!
@kidswong999 (0, 56, 41, -41, -51, 41)
这是我的阈值 -
RE: 巡线小车运行程序,一直出现IDE interrupt,无法运行得到所巡的线!
@kidswong999 我实际是蓝色线,我把阈值修改为蓝色的了
假如是mag拟合度这里:【 if line.magnitude()>8:】限制了后面轨迹线的出现,我修改过拟合度的值,使之变小,直至为0,也不行的... -
RE: 巡线小车运行程序,一直出现IDE interrupt,无法运行得到所巡的线!
@kidswong999 是这段:【img.draw_line(line.line(), color = 127)】函数不运行呀
-
RE: 巡线小车运行程序,一直出现IDE interrupt,无法运行得到所巡的线!
@kidswong999 这种效果也不行啊!而且拟合度是是不影响绿色的轨迹线的出现吧?
-
RE: 巡线小车运行程序,一直出现IDE interrupt,无法运行得到所巡的线!
@kidswong999 我试了 rho_err = abs(line.rho())-img.width()/2
if line.theta()>90:
theta_err = line.theta()-180
else:
theta_err = line.theta()
img.draw_line(line.line(), color = 127)
print(line)
if line.magnitude()>8:
#if -40<b_err<40 and -30<t_err<30:
rho_output = rho_pid.get_pid(rho_err,1)
theta_output = theta_pid.get_pid(theta_err,1)
这里改为print(line),也不行